Abstract
A ternary orthorhombic phase (Pbma, a = 2.34, b = 1.62 and c = 2.00 nm) was revealed around the Al77Rh15Ru8 composition. It is structurally related to the Al–Rh and Al–Pd ɛ-phases.
► New intermetallic Al77Rh15Ru8 phase was found in the Al–Rh–Ru system. ► The new phase has an orthorhombic cell with a = 2.34, b = 1.62 and c = 2.00 nm. ► Its crystal symmetry can be described by the Pbma (no. 57) space group. ► The [0 1 0] ED pattern taken from the new phase exhibits pseudo-10fold symmetry. ► Structural relation of the Al77Rh15Ru8 phase to the ɛ-phases is discussed.
